How much does it cost to rent a home in Mall?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Mall 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,687 | $3,000 | $5,000 |
Mall 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,963 | $4,100 | $5,990 |
Mall 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$5,325 | $4,600 | $6,050 |
Mall 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,276 | $1,160 | $1,360 |
Mall 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$5,750 | $5,750 | $5,750 |
Mall 7 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,100 | $980 | $1,310 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Mall
What type of rentals are currently available in Mall?
There are currently 231 Apartments for Rent in Mall, DC with pricing that ranges from $1,246 to $17,219. There are also 127 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Mall ranging from $980 to $12,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Mall?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Mall ranges from $980 to $12,000 with an average monthly rent of $4,287.
